Public tree growing through fence

Reported via mobile in the Tree Requires Pruning category anonymously at 12:18, Friday 16 May 2025 using FixMyStreet Pro

Sent to Bromley Council less than a minute later. FixMyStreet ref: 7578670.

The image shows where a tree on public land (regularly maintained by contractors on behalf of the council) has grown through and damaged the rear fence of our garden. This has evidently been an issue for some time given the maturity of the tree.
